Transaction 9112d48cdbae214ddf2823289085ff7db787c3546b4aa6f7c3fa5200a045f026

1 Input
2 Outputs
  • 9112d48cdbae214ddf2823289085ff7db787c3546b4aa6f7c3fa5200a045f026:0
  • value  13453119543
    address  18MBM8umeDF9DzEcgnCi7GkeqX2jyzUU8h
  • 9112d48cdbae214ddf2823289085ff7db787c3546b4aa6f7c3fa5200a045f026:1
  • value  40000000
    address  17vpLTjTrQq72YDSYpYkwNPJTjssygjNCy